Fallout Shelter earned $5.1m in two weeks – Superdata
The iOS release of Fallout Shelter pulled in more than $5m in its first two weeks, according to Superdata’s latest monthly report on digital sales figures. The company credits the spin-off’s success to Bethesda pulling off the minor miracle of getting core gamers to step into and stick around for …

eSports tournament Vulcun Deckmasters has been cancelled, despite only launching last month. Gosugamers reports that Vulcun launched the competition with the promise of a $100k prize pool over two seasons.
